MY TOP 3 BODY MOISTURISERS: EVERY DAY, EVENING & GRADUAL TAN

As the weather has been getting warmer I've found myself reaching for body moisturisers much more frequently - not only to help lock in my tan, fake or natural, but to keep my skin hydrated in the heat. 
I've decided to split my favourite moisturisers in 3 categories: Every Day, Evening and Gradual Tanning. These are my favourites that I've discovered - 
Every Day 

Derma Vio Coconut Body Butter, 99p - Body Care

I'm a great lover of anything coconut scented, so when I came across this cheap and cheerful Derma Vio body butter from Savers, I couldn't resist. The consistancy is super luxurious and creamy, but doesn't feel too heavy on the skin. It's perfect for everyday use. In comparison to The Body Shops coconut body butter, it has a similar feel, however the scent doesn't last on the skin along as  The Body Shops version, but for a fraction of the price this body butter is a steal.

Evening

The Body Shop's White Musk Sun Glow Body Purée - £9.00

This is a new addition to my collection of body moisturisers and it's fast become my favourite. The Body Shops white musk sun Glow body purée is a lightly whipped, refreshing take on the classic body lotion. For me, it was the scent that won me over - it smells absolutely divine, it reminds me of an exotic summery concoction with a mix of parma violets. Honestly, if you haven't smelt this, you need to! 
The consistency is really light weight and the scent is extremely long lasting, almost acting as a perfume. I added this as an evening moisturiser as I think it will add a perfect glow and scent for summer nights out. 

Gradual Tanning

Garnier Summer Body - £2.53 (on offer at Superdrug at the moment, RRP £5.06)

I've always been a big fan of gradual tanners in the moisturiser form, as it gives the skin a break from heavy fake tans. Garnier Summer Body has been my gradual tanner of choice for about 3 weeks now and I don't think I'd ever change. The colour pay off with this tan is a beautiful bronze glow, without having too much of a nasty fake tan, biscuity smell. I've been loving this product as of late, especially with the weather in England perking up. I apply it after a day in the sun, and it adds an extra boost to my natural tan, with no tango orange in sight.
